Navigating the Emotional Rollercoaster: Coping with Pregnancy Hormones

Pregnancy is an incredible journey filled with joy, excitement, and anticipation. However, it's also a time when your body goes through a lot of changes, including hormonal fluctuations that can sometimes feel like riding a rollercoaster of emotions.

 

One minute you might be overjoyed about becoming a parent, and the next, you might find yourself crying over something that seems trivial. It's important to remember that these mood swings are normal and are often caused by hormonal changes happening in your body.

 

One way to cope with these emotional ups and downs is to acknowledge and accept your feelings. It's okay to feel overwhelmed, anxious, or even irritable at times. Talking to your partner, friends, or healthcare provider about how you're feeling can help you feel supported and understood.

 

Finding healthy ways to manage stress can also make a big difference. This could include practising relaxation techniques like deep breathing or mindfulness, getting regular exercise, or doing activities that bring you joy, like listening to music or going for a walk in nature.

 

Finally, don't forget to take care of yourself both mentally and physically. Eating a balanced diet, getting enough rest, and staying hydrated can all help keep your hormones in check and improve your overall well-being during pregnancy.

 

In conclusion, managing your emotions all through pregnancy might be difficult, but you can endure the emotional rollercoaster calmly and strongly if you acknowledge your feelings, take care of yourself, and create effective techniques for stress.
